A historical glance at steel fenestration's progress

The story of steel windows traces back to the 19th century, progressing from early cast iron and wrought iron applications to the refined architectural steel windows seen today. Initially, metal windows were primarily utilized in industrial settings, giving rise to the term industrial windows, prized for their might and skill to span large openings. These early steel windows paved the way for more advanced designs and wider adoption.

By the early 20th century, steel fenestration gained important traction in both steel commercial windows and emerging residential designs. The inherent durability and slim profiles offered by steel windows presented distinct steel windows benefits over other materials, leading to their integration into imposing public buildings and upscale homes. This period indicated the transition towards truly architectural windows, with modern steel windows increasingly liked for their sleek aesthetics and strong performance, laying the groundwork for contemporary steel residential windows and fold steel architectural windows solutions.

Grasping steel window frame building

Grasping the basic construction of Steel Windows is vital for appreciating their durability and design versatility. Typically, Steel Windows frames are fabricated from hot-rolled or cold-rolled steel profiles, meticulously welded at the corners to create a sturdy, seamless unit. This process allows for extraordinary strength in slender sections, enabling extensive glazing areas and maximizing natural light, a trademark of superb Steel Windows design.

The intricate manufacturing process supports various steel window designs and steel window styles, including classic steel awning windows, large steel bay windows, and elegant steel picture windows. Customization is intrinsic in Steel Windows, with individual components precisely cut and joined to meet certain architectural requirements. Your guide to thermal performance and fenestration options in steel windows

Modern steel windows provide outstanding thermal performance through sophisticated glazing and thermally broken frame designs. These innovations ensure that steel windows contribute advantageously to a building's energy efficiency, peculiarly critical for Nederland homes.

The answer to enhanced thermal performance in steel frame windows lies in the implementation of thermally broken technology. This entails creating a barrier within the steel frames themselves, obstructing the transfer of heat or cold through the metal. Coupled with high-performance glazing options like double or triple-pane insulated glass units (IGUs), steel framed windows effectively lessen heat loss in winter and heat gain in summer. Specialists in steel window frames understand that selecting the appropriate glass coatings and gas fills (argon or krypton) within the IGUs further optimizes the thermal resistance of steel windows, making them a smart choice for various climates.

Top practices when placing steel window systems

Correct installation is paramount for maximizing the lifespan and performance of Steel Windows. Achieving ideal thermal performance depends heavily on meticulous sealing around the entire steel window installation, preventing air and moisture infiltration. Selecting appropriate glazing options and ensuring they are correctly seated within the frame significantly impacts the overall thermal efficiency of Steel Windows.

The accurate setting of Steel Windows, including ensuring level and plumb positioning, is crucial. Careful handling of the glazing during installation hinders damage and ensures a firm, thermally sound seal. For glass windows, especially those with specialized glazing options, proper shimming and anchoring are essential to maintain structural integrity and prevent stress on the steel windows frames over time.

Matching steel as a window frame material with substitutes

While various materials exist for window frames, Steel Windows provide distinct benefits over aluminum, vinyl, and wood options. Unlike aluminum, Steel Windows possess superior strength-to-weight ratios, allowing for incredibly thin frames and larger glass expanses without compromising structural integrity or long-term durability. The inherent strength of steel also contributes to excellent weatherization, creating sturdy seals at crucial points like sills.

Opposed to vinyl, Steel Windows possess unmatched toughness against temperature fluctuations and UV degradation, preventing warping or fading over time. Furthermore, the longevity and minimal maintenance of Steel Windows often surpass even bronze alternatives, especially concerning long-term structural performance in challenging climates.
